Abstract
The most significant morphophysiological structure of the thyroid gland is a tissue microregion that combines a group of follicles and interfollicular space with an autonomous system of blood and lymph circulation. It is the structures of the tissue microregion that suffer the most under the action of pathogenic factors on the thyroid gland, reducing its role in providing morphological and metabolic changes in tissues and organs. But morphological and morphometric changes in the thyroid gland during polypharmacy with anti-inflammatory drugs are poorly understood.
